Output 659c343d771148ae5f3e445e1871f2db881513ea284a1878d906e85c9f1764b9:6

value
31890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 867e65d5e8083ef0bda13f04481b16a61fbb7a1d OP_EQUAL
address
3Dx9tXDbw7y4TJXT1eaQuYPwTrjw46gyWP
transaction
659c343d771148ae5f3e445e1871f2db881513ea284a1878d906e85c9f1764b9
spent
true